League recap: Sprague extends winning streak with victory over North Salem

Sprague extended the longest winning streak in 6A Central Valley this week by beating North Salem, 55-27. This was the team's sixth consecutive win.

McNary took down McKay 48-7 last week, the largest margin of any game. hayden gosling threw for 128 yards and 2 touchdowns in the win.

Thomas Harris was a passing and rushing force as Sprague bested the Vikings. Harris' favorite target this week was Bryce Johnson, who caught 2 passes for 50 yards.

Jorge Garibay was the best receiver in the league this week as the Scots fell to the Celtics. Garibay racked up 4 receptions for 79 yards. Logan Dickey helped McKay's passing attack out by catching 1 ball for 65 yards.

The leading receiver in the league this season is Devin Rediger. The Sprague star has 29 catches for 473 yards.

Next week's game between McKay and Jay Minyard's team will feature a good passing match up as Sam Harris will test his arm against Rediger's defensive ability. So far this year Brett Rhodes' team's Harris has 1,512 yards and 11 touchdowns to his credit, while Rediger has notched 5 interceptions for the Olympians.

A big matchup in the league this week will be when West Salem takes on McNary. The Titans are currently in first, while Isaac Parker's team is in third.

The top two defenses in the league will face off this season when West Salem takes on the Celtics. Shawn Stanley's team has allowed 191 points this season, while McNary has given up 207.

Sprague led 6A Central Valley in scoring this week by notching 55 points on North Salem. Harris ran for 196 yards during the win.
